I-22-06 Fuel Pump May Fail – 2021-2022 Indian Motorcycles

November 11, 2022 N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 22V837000

Fuel Pump May Fail

Fuel pump failure can cause an engine stall, increasing the risk of a crash.

 

NHTSA Campaign Number: 22V837000

Manufacturer IndianeBay logo Motorcycle Company

Components F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E

Potential Number of Units Affected 7,811

 

Summary

IndianeBay logo Motorcycle Company (IndianeBay logo)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Scout, Scout Bobber Sixty, Scout Bobber, Scout Icon, Scout Sixty, Scout Bobber Twenty, Scout Bobber Icon, 2022 Scout Rogue Sixty, Chief, Chief Bobber, Chief Bobber Dark Horse, Chief Dark Horse, Scout Rogue, Super Chief, and Super Chief Limited motorcycles. The fuel pump may fail while riding.

 

Remedy

Dealers will replace the fuel pump and the fuel pump seal,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 6, 2022. Owners may contact IndianeBay logo customer service at 1-877-204-3697. IndianeBay logo’s number for this recall is I-22-06.

Indian Motorcycle I-22-06 Safety Recall Chief and Scout Fuel Pump FAQ

Version: R02 (April 13, 2023)

 

What changed with the I-22-06 April 13, 2023 update?

Repair procedure updates including secondary audit step(s), updated pictures, and clarified verbiage have been added to the repair instructions. A required training has been added for I-22-06.

 

What is the purpose of the I-22-06 Safety Recall?

IndianeBay logo Motorcycle has determined that some Model Year 2022 Chief and Model Year 2021-2022 Scout motorcycles may experience a failure at the fuel pump during operation. If this occurs, the engine may stall increasing the risk of a crash and serious injury.

To address this concern, IndianeBay logo Motorcycle has released this safety recall with instructions to replace the fuel pump with an improved part.

 

What make & model year is included in this Safety Recall?

Some 2022 Chief models and 2021-2022 Scout models.

What parts are required to update the vehicles affected by this recall, and will dealers need to order them?  Chief models require; a new fuel pump (Part Number 2522501), fuel pump seal (Part Number 5414830) and a cable tie (Part Number 7080138).

Scout models require; a new fuel pump (Part Number 2521733), and a fuel pump seal (Part Number 5414830).  Dealers will need to order each part individually as needed. There is no parts kit for I-22-06.

 

What if parts are showing on backorder or not available? 

Dealers should still place orders for the quantities required. It’s important to get all orders entered into the system so PolariseBay logo can track demand and keep parts shipping to dealers.

 

Are the parts returnable if a dealer over orders? 

No. IndianeBay logo Motorcycle’s standard RMA policy excludes the return of Safety Recall parts.

Will dealers be paid for performing this Safety Recall? 

Yes. Dealers will be reimbursed for the cost of parts and labor to perform the recall.

 

Can I allow demos on vehicles that havent had I-22-06 performed? 

Yes. This is NOT a Stop Ride, so vehicles that haven’t had the update performed can still be driven (both consumer and dealer vehicles). However, we recommend providing demo rides on vehicles that have had the update completed, and therefore can be retailed immediately.

Chronology :

In August 2022, as part of IndianeBay logo Motorcycle’s routine review of warranty claims, IndianeBay logo Motorcycle identified an increased rate of fuel pump failures. Thereafter, IndianeBay logo Motorcycle began an investigation, which included outreach to the fuel pump supplier, inspection of failed fuel pumps from units in the field and testing performed internally.

In October 2022, IndianeBay logo Motorcycle learned from the fuel pump supplier that beginning in March 2021, the impeller within the fuel pump was manufactured thicker than the engineering specification, which could result in fuel pump failure during operation. This was a known quality issue that was previously identified by the supplier, but not communicated to IndianeBay logo Motorcycle at the time.

During the investigation, IndianeBay logo Motorcycle identified 180 reports of fuel pump failures, including 26 reports of engine stalls. IndianeBay logo Motorcycle has not identified any reports involving a crash, injuries, or deaths related to this reported issue, and has not identified any associated NDFRs.

On November 4, 2022, IndianeBay logo Motorcycle’s Executive Review Committee decided that the fuel pump failure during operation resulting in an engine stall resulted in a safety-related defect.
